All can compromise … Web7 de fev. de 2024 · Meniscus tears can limit flexion and extension of the knee due to pain or blockage of movement in the joint. For example, a portion of the torn meniscus can obstruct the normal mechanics of the knee joint. WebIf a tear of the later meniscus occurs, it can be minor or severe. In a severe lateral meniscus tear, the meniscus can be torn in half, ripped around its circumference, or ripped to the extent that it hangs on by a fiber. Patients who suffer a tear of the lateral meniscus may have minor or moderate pain and limited movement of the knee joint.
